AI Companies Seek 16.8 Million Square Feet of Office Space, Providing Massive New Demand for Struggling Sector
Artificial intelligence firms are driving a massive recovery in premium commercial real estate, seeking 16.8 million square feet of office space across 17 major U.S. markets.

Artificial intelligence companies are currently seeking a staggering 16.8 million square feet of office space across 17 major U.S. markets, according to recent industry data. This surge represents an 85 percent year-over-year increase in national AI office demand, making the sector the undisputed engine of commercial real estate recovery. Among all active technology industry requirements tracked by real estate analysts, AI tenants now account for 34 percent of the total count and nearly half of all active square footage. The sheer scale of this demand is forcing property owners and city planners to rapidly adjust their expectations for the future of downtown business districts.[1][2]
Unlike previous technology cycles that fully embraced remote work and decentralized teams, the current wave of artificial intelligence development is heavily and intentionally office-centric. Building complex large language models, designing custom silicon chips, and developing specialized enterprise applications requires intense, in-person collaboration that is difficult to replicate over video conferencing. Furthermore, these companies are locked in a fierce, high-stakes battle for a very small pool of specialized engineering talent. To win over top-tier researchers, AI firms are increasingly using high-end, collaborative physical headquarters as a primary recruiting tool, designing workspaces that foster innovation and signal institutional stability.[3]
This massive physical expansion is directly fueled by historic, record-breaking levels of venture capital entering the artificial intelligence sector. In the first quarter of 2026 alone, U.S. private AI funding reached an astonishing $206 billion, approaching the $217 billion raised throughout the entirety of 2025. When these companies secure mega-rounds of funding—which now frequently exceed $100 million per deal—their immediate next steps are hiring specialized talent and securing the physical infrastructure required to house them. This creates a direct, undeniable pipeline between Silicon Valley venture capital term sheets and commercial real estate leasing activity across the country.[2][3]
However, this commercial real estate boom is not distributed evenly across the country, creating a polarized market of winners and losers. The demand is hyper-concentrated, with 63 percent of the 16.8 million square feet sought located in just three metropolitan areas: San Francisco, Silicon Valley, and New York City. This extreme concentration means that national office statistics hide dramatically different conditions at the local level. One specific technology corridor might experience intense competition, rising rents, and bidding wars for premium space, while a neighboring district in the exact same city continues to struggle with high vacancy rates and distressed properties.[1][2][3]

San Francisco serves as the undeniable epicenter of this real estate transformation. The city accounts for approximately 5 million square feet—or a full 25 percent—of all AI-related office demand in the United States. Since 2019, AI companies have leased 21 million square feet of office space in San Francisco and Silicon Valley, a physical footprint equivalent to 15 Salesforce Towers. This massive influx of well-funded tenants is driving the city's office vacancy rate down from its pandemic peak, signaling a structural recovery in its prime markets and breathing new life into neighborhoods that had seen significant corporate exoduses.[2][6]
In New York City, the market dynamic is slightly different but equally robust. While San Francisco is dominated by massive foundation-model laboratories, New York's demand skews heavily toward application-layer AI tenants and infrastructure companies serving the city's massive financial, legal, and media base. AI companies in New York leased roughly 415,000 square feet in the first quarter of 2026, effectively doubling their total leasing volume from the previous year. Crucially, their average space requirement jumped from 16,600 to 34,500 square feet, indicating that these AI startups are rapidly maturing from small, scrappy operations into significant institutional tenants.[2][3]
The expansion is also spilling over into international financial centers, proving that the AI real estate boom is a global phenomenon. In London, AI-related office take-up reached over 705,000 square feet in the first half of 2026, a figure more than four times higher than the same period in 2025. Major players like Anthropic have signed landmark leases in the city's Knowledge Quarter, cementing AI's position as a dominant force in global prime office leasing. Globally, AI companies represented 17 percent of all technology-sector office deals in the first half of 2026, a massive leap from just 3 percent two years earlier.[5][7]
To mitigate the inherent risks of hyper-growth, many AI firms are turning to flexible workspace operators rather than committing immediately to traditional leases. Flexible providers recorded the highest proportion of expansionary deals in the first half of 2026, with 78 percent of their transactions involving additional space. These operators are aggressively taking more space in established tech hubs to accommodate AI startups that need room to scale rapidly. By utilizing flex space, founders can avoid the rigid, decade-long commitments of traditional commercial leases, preserving their capital for compute power and talent acquisition while still providing premium collaborative environments.[4][5]
Despite the widespread optimism among commercial landlords, this concentrated demand introduces new vulnerabilities for the broader real estate market. The AI leasing boom is deeply tethered to venture capital flows, which are historically cyclical and can change quickly based on macroeconomic conditions. A company signing a massive, long-term lease today is betting heavily that future funding rounds will materialize to support its expanded physical footprint and high cash burn rate. If the venture capital spigot slows, landlords heavily exposed to AI tenants could face a sudden wave of sublease space hitting the market.[3]
Furthermore, the AI surge is not a universal panacea for the broader office sector's structural challenges. Nationally, office-using employment remains below the levels seen before generative AI gained widespread attention, and millions of square feet of older, outdated inventory remain completely vacant. AI firms are highly selective, competing almost exclusively for premium, Class A spaces that offer robust power infrastructure and top-tier amenities. This "flight to quality" leaves older, Class B and C buildings behind, forcing their owners to consider costly residential conversions or face obsolescence.[3]
For local businesses and traditional tenants operating in these major AI hubs, the real estate landscape is becoming increasingly competitive and expensive. As well-funded AI firms absorb the best premium space, availability in specific corridors is dropping rapidly and asking rents are stabilizing or rising. Traditional industries—from legal services to traditional finance—are now forced to adapt their real estate strategies, navigating a market that is suddenly, and selectively, heating up again. For the commercial real estate sector, AI has provided a desperately needed lifeline, but one that is rewriting the map of where and how business gets done.

Key terms
- Class A Office Space
- The highest quality office buildings in a market, featuring top-tier amenities, modern infrastructure, and prime locations.
- Net Absorption
- The total amount of space leased over a specific period minus the total amount of space vacated by tenants.
- Flexible Workspace
- Office space that is leased on short-term, adaptable contracts, often fully furnished and managed by a third-party operator.
- Submarket
- A specific geographic area within a larger metropolitan commercial real estate market, such as the Mission District in San Francisco.
- Venture Capital
- Private equity financing provided to startup companies that are believed to have long-term growth potential.
